### Changelog — Marrowpipe broker 7.0 upgrade

Upgrading from 6.x changes several defaults. Consumer prefetch is lower, idle connections are reaped faster, and dead-letter routing is on by default. If queues back up after the rollout, check prefetch first.

Rollback path: pin the 6.4 image and restore the old overrides from the deploy repo. Page the broker channel before rolling back in prod.

The new post-upgrade defaults are as follows.

service settings:
[pelius]
port = 5432
team = praius
host = pelius.crelvoforge.internal
region = upper-4
access_code = ac_8f224d
timeout_ms = 2000

**Finance Review Summary — Support Outsourcing, Pellgrave Systems**

The proposal to outsource customer support to Ashdown Contact Group projects annual savings of 1.2 million after transition costs. Headcount impact is limited to the Ferndale call centre. Service-level risk is rated moderate; penalty clauses are included in the draft contract. The board should weigh the savings against the strategic consideration noted below.

internal memo for hafog-hadug: The pricing group signed off on a budget of $16.1 million for Project Gorir. The renewal with Oliionax Systems closes at $14.1 million a year, 46 percent above the last contract.

**Q: What was the cron drift thing everyone mentions?**

A: Last quarter, scheduled jobs on the Marlowe cluster started firing up to four minutes late because of an NTP misconfiguration after a kernel upgrade. It's fixed, but some reports still reference backfilled data. If a client asks about gaps from that window, point them to the writeup on the internal incident page.

dashboard of yahaf-kajep = https://jira.zemvarsys.internal/display/projects/browse/browse/a08b